To answer your questions on the creation of Dead On Arrival,

I played two tracks of guitar, using amp modeling on my eBand.
The Marshall JCM120 with the gain at 40 percent and tone controls
at 50 percent. The keyboard track was actually created on an
iPod Touch. The sound effects were added on a computer, using
Adobe Audition 3.0 software.

The final recording was done on an eBand JS-8 (Boss).

Gene. We recently increased the limit from 5MB to 6MB. I doubt that we'll be increasing it any more than that in the near future. What I suggest you do instead is get some web space somewhere and store your larger files there. Then, instead of attaching your song to your message, you can link to it using the [singlemp3][/singlemp3] tags. This will result in the same MP3 player gadget that appears when you attach a song, but the file won't be taking space on our server.

For example, here's the URL of a song I have stored at weebly.com:

http://64guitars.weebly.com/uploads/3/9/7/9/3979195/dr64.mp3

If I wanted to include that song in a message here, I'd simply paste the URL between the [singlemp3][/singlemp3] tags like this:

[singlemp3]http://64guitars.weebly.com/uploads/3/9/7/9/3979195/dr64.mp3[/singlemp3]

When the message is posted, it looks like this:

Time:
0:00
Volume:
50
0
               


This particular song is extremely short so the file size is very small. But you could link in the same way to files of any size stored offsite.

Examples of sites where you can get some free storage are Fileden and weebly.com. At weebly.com, songs are limited to 5MB each with the free account. But you can get a premium account for a small fee which has a 100MB limit per file, with no limit on the number of files you can have.


Another option some people here use is to store your files at SoundClick. Then you can include them in your message with the [soundclick][/soundclick] tags. Simply insert the SoundClick song ID between the tags (see this message).
